I’ll Fly Away captures the meeting point between structure and freedom. This piece contrasts a grounded lower field of layered earth tones with an open upper plane, where a small flock of birds takes flight across muted sky.
Textured plaster and embedded fragments evoke the marks of time and touch, while the flock of birds bring a sense of movement and light.
It’s both deeply emotional and visually calm — a quiet celebration of transformation, release, and the unseen courage it takes to move on.
Created from textured acrylic paint on cardboard, this contemporary painting embodies the wabi-sabi philosophy — beauty found in impermanence and transition.
Each work in the Attachment Series reflects a personal meditation on what it means to stay grounded yet remain free.
